  • Interesting. I purchased an unlock code from cellunlocker.net and they gave me a code that was 16 digits long, but split into 2 lots of eight digits. They said it would be either 1 or the other. Ofcourse i tried both 8 digit codes seperately and neither one worked.

    Now I am waiting for a refund, but I might have to try all 16 digits and see whether that works.

    • I got 16 digits codes which split into 2 lots of eight digits from gsmliberty.net. Of course it does not work. No matter 16 digits or 8 digits. I have been told that the code is the outcome from their search in their database 1. Actually, in this database, their is no code for DEFY+. Then, a random code has been generated. They offered me a fully refund or a further search in their database 2 which includes codes for the latest models. But it costs another $5 more and takes 1-3days. I choosed the refund and got refund in 10 hours.
